#233803 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#233803 is composed of 13.7% red, 22%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 83.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 11.6%. #233803 color hex could be obtained by blending #467006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#233803 color description : Very dark green.

#233803 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#233803 has RGB values of R:35, G:56,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 2308099.

Shades and Tints of #233803

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7feed is the lightest one.

Tones of #233803

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1f1c is the less saturated color, while #233a01 is the most saturated one.
